A ratio can be a useful metric, but to understand it you need either the numerator or the denominator, otherwise information is lost. I have a feeling the answer to your question is in part that Montana may not be that expensive but that the average income is low. Combine this with new home construction costs and that out west, lots of land is restricted government land or the infrastructure is not in place to easily build or what is being built is geared for rich Hollywood types who need a second or third home to sink their millions into. The average Joe can’t keep up with those economic pressures.

During the Plandemic people flooded into Bozeman and Big Sky mainly, although all the towns near a ski area in the state saw triple digit appreciation over a two year period.
Remote work is the main culprit.
Also “Yellowstone” the show has increased interest, and Costner keeps running around talking about the mountains and how great it all is...without mentioning that most of the production is done in and around Park City.
Houses that sold for $300K in 2018 now sell for $650-700K, in a state that has virtually no manufacturing jobs, just construction and hospitality. Thus the adverse price to earnings ratio.
